What are the current trends in collaborations between pharma and tech?

Current trends in collaborations between pharma and tech include the integration of artificial intelligence (AI) for drug discovery, the use of digital health technologies for patient monitoring, and partnerships focused on data analytics to enhance clinical trials. For instance, AI is increasingly utilized to analyze vast datasets, accelerating the identification of potential drug candidates, as evidenced by a report from McKinsey & Company indicating that AI can reduce drug development timelines by up to 30%. Additionally, digital health tools, such as wearables and telehealth platforms, are being adopted to improve patient engagement and real-time health monitoring, which was highlighted in the 2023 HIMSS Global Health Conference. Furthermore, collaborations are increasingly centered around leveraging big data to optimize clinical trial designs, with companies like Pfizer and IBM Watson Health showcasing successful partnerships that utilize data analytics to streamline trial processes and improve outcomes.

What specific technologies are being integrated into pharmaceutical practices?

Artificial intelligence, machine learning, blockchain, and telemedicine are specific technologies being integrated into pharmaceutical practices. These technologies enhance drug discovery, streamline supply chain management, and improve patient engagement. For instance, AI and machine learning algorithms analyze vast datasets to identify potential drug candidates more efficiently, while blockchain ensures secure and transparent tracking of pharmaceuticals throughout the supply chain. Telemedicine facilitates remote patient monitoring and consultations, thereby improving access to healthcare services.

What are the challenges faced in pharma-tech collaborations?

What are the challenges faced in pharma-tech collaborations?

Pharma-tech collaborations face several challenges, including regulatory hurdles, differing corporate cultures, and data integration issues. Regulatory hurdles arise from the complex landscape of healthcare regulations that both sectors must navigate, often leading to delays in project timelines. Differing corporate cultures can create friction, as pharmaceutical companies typically prioritize safety and compliance, while tech firms may focus on innovation and speed. Data integration issues stem from the disparate systems used by both industries, making it difficult to share and analyze data effectively. These challenges can hinder the potential benefits of collaboration, such as improved patient outcomes and accelerated drug development.

How do differing priorities between pharma and tech impact project timelines?

Differing priorities between pharmaceutical companies and technology firms significantly impact project timelines by creating misalignments in goals and processes. Pharmaceutical companies often prioritize regulatory compliance, patient safety, and clinical efficacy, which can lead to longer approval processes and extended timelines. In contrast, technology firms typically focus on rapid innovation, scalability, and market competitiveness, which can result in a faster pace of development. This divergence can cause delays as both parties negotiate timelines that accommodate the slower, more methodical approach of pharma with the agile methodologies favored by tech. What metrics should be used to evaluate the success of collaborations?

To evaluate the success of collaborations between pharma and tech, key metrics include project completion rates, return on investment (ROI), and stakeholder satisfaction. Project completion rates measure the percentage of collaborative initiatives that meet their objectives within the designated timeframe, indicating operational efficiency. ROI assesses the financial gains relative to the costs incurred during the collaboration, providing insight into economic viability. Stakeholder satisfaction gauges the perceived value and effectiveness of the collaboration from the perspectives of all involved parties, ensuring alignment with strategic goals.
